Baked Lemon-Pepper Tilapia with Roasted Zucchini and Quinoa
Prep 15 min · Cook 25 min · Serves 4 · medium

A light and fresh dinner featuring baked lemon-pepper tilapia, paired with roasted zucchini and fluffy quinoa. This dish is high in protein, fiber, and complex carbs - perfect for a GLP-1 medication-friendly meal.
Ingredients
- 4 6-oz tilapia fillets, or other white fish like cod
- 3 medium zucchini, sliced into half-moons
- 1 cup quinoa, dry, rinsed
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- 1 tsp black pepper
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1/2 tsp salt
Instructions
- 1
Preheat oven to 400°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- 2
In a small bowl, mix together the lemon juice, black pepper, garlic powder, and 1 tbsp of olive oil. Place the tilapia fillets on the prepared baking sheet and brush them with the lemon-pepper mixture.
